Bollywood Divas As Barbie
The AI tool used breathtaking outfits, flawless makeup, and hairstyles to give these beauties a Barbie-like appearance, and of course, the results have us head over heels.
In the post, AI reimagined Anushka Sharma in a stunning pink outfit with Barbie-like makeup and hairstyle. Alia Bhatt looks like a doll in a multi-colored outfit and a rose headband. Parineeti Chopra can be seen in a multi-colored dress. Many users agree Aishwarya Rai is the perfect fit for the Barbie role. The other actresses that the artist imagined as Barbies are Kareena Kapoor, Deepika Padukone, Katrina Kaif, Disha Patani, Aishwarya Rai, and Shraddha Kapoor. The artist also imagined Bollywood superstar Shah Rukh Khan’s daughter Suhana Khan as Barbie, and gosh, she looks beautiful.
The post was shared on Instagram by AI artist Sahid with the caption, “Bollywood Meets Barbie. What if Barbie was made in India? Bollywood Divas as Indian Barbie Icons: Redefining Dreams!”

Fun Facts About Barbie:
•Although we are reimagining Kat as a Barbie, she had already done it. Katrina Kaif is the first Indian actress to have a plastic doll made in her name and she did this back in 2009
•There are 176 dolls with nine body types, 35 skin tones, and 94 hairstyles. Other recent additions include Barbies wearing a hearing aid, and hijabs, and using other tools. This is done to increase inclusivity and diversity.
•Barbie is more than just a doll. The brand does $1 billion in sales across more than 150 countries annually, and 92% of American girls ages 3 to 12 have owned a Barbie.
•The world’s most expensive Barbie is Diamond Barbie. She costs $302,500 and was created by Australian Jewellery Designer Stefano Canturi in 2010
•According to Mattel, 2 Barbies are sold every second! In 2021, over 86 million Barbie dolls were sold, that’s around 164 Barbies sold every minute.
